- The muscular tube connecting the pharynx and stomach that moves food by peristalsis is the esophagus.
- Mucus lubricates and protects the stomach from harsh acidic conditions.
- The innermost layer of the stomach with epithelium and a thin - layer of smooth muscle is the mucosa.
- Canines are used for cutting and tearing food.
- The layer of the stomach made of fibrous connective tissue and the Meissner's plexus is the submucosa.
